无法使用ImageField,因为未安装Pillow


CommandError: System check identified some issues:
ERRORS:
estore.Header.img: (fields.E210) Cannot use ImageField because Pillow is not installed.
HINT: Get Pillow at https://pypi.python.org/pypi/Pillow or run command "python -m pip install pillow".
products.Product.img: (fields.E210) Cannot use ImageField because Pillow is not installed.
HINT: Get Pillow at https://pypi.python.org/pypi/Pillow or run command "python -m pip install pillow".

我安装了最新版本的枕头(7.2.0(

requirement already satisfied pillow in c:usersadminappdatalocalprogramspythonpython38libsite-packages (7.2.0)

我使用的是python版本3.8.5、visual studio版本v16.7.0和Django 3.1请帮帮我!

尝试在虚拟环境中安装抱枕!

cmd:

workon [your virtual env]
pip install Pillow

如果这不起作用,试试这个:

pip uninstall Pillow
pip install Pillow==5.0.0

我想我将能够回答这个问题
我的系统信息如下:

  • Windows 10
  • Django 3.2版
  • Python 3.7版

我在Pillow文档中发现,经过测试的Pillow版本为7.1.0
您可以在此处阅读
为此,您需要启动cmd或anaconda提示符并键入

pip uninstall Pillow
pip install Pillow==7.1.0

相关内容

最新更新